低代码后端开发:《低代码后端开发技巧》
近年来,低代码开发逐渐成为技术界讨论的热门话题。它不仅改变了传统开发的繁琐流程,也为开发者们节省了大量的时间和精力。而在后端开发这个领域,低代码开发同样掀起了一场革命,让复杂的数据处理、业务逻辑搭建变得更加简单高效。
今天,我们就一起来探讨一下低代码技术在后端开发中的妙用,以及如何更好地利用这些低代码工具提升效率。无论你是个资深开发者,还是刚入门的萌新,相信这篇文章都能提供一些有用的思路。
在深入探讨之前,我们先来简单了解一下什么是低代码后端开发。用最简单的话来说,低代码后端开发就是通过配置化和可视化的方式,减少手写代码量,从而快速高效地实现后端业务逻辑的一种开发模式。在这种模式中,开发者不需要从头到尾编写复杂的代码,而是利用平台提供的预置功能模块,像拼积木一样完成开发工作。
举个例子吧,以往我们可能需要几天时间才能完成用户认证的功能,而现在,使用低代码开发工具,只需拖拽几个模块、配置一下参数,这些冗长的代码工作就可以被快速完成。是不是听起来就让人跃跃欲试?
虽然低代码开发听起来非常诱人,但并不是所有的开发场景都适合用它来解决问题。它主要更适合满足一些特定的需求,比如:
不过,如果是非常复杂的大型系统,或者需要高度定制化的功能实现,单纯依赖低代码工具可能并不是最佳选择。这时候,你可能更需要结合传统编程手段来实现灵活的功能。
低代码虽然能简化开发流程,但要做好后端开发,依然需要一些关键技巧,以下是几个不可忽视的点:
低代码的核心优势在于快速响应业务需求。因此,作为开发者,深入了解业务场景是第一步。无论是建设报表系统、搭建用户管理后台,还是构建订单处理中心,只有理解业务的核心需求,才能选择合适的工具和开发流程。
低代码开发平台通常会提供丰富的预置功能模块,比如CRUD操作、角色权限管理、数据导入导出等。作为开发者,我们要学会充分利用这些模块,它们可以让你花更少的时间完成更复杂的功能。
数据处理是后端开发中的重头戏。低代码工具往往提供直观的数据库操作界面,允许我们快速配置数据模型和关系。在设计数据结构时,一定要时刻考虑数据扩展性和性能问题,避免出现"先易后难"的情况。
虽然低代码工具主打的是免代码或少代码,但往往提供脚本功能和扩展接口用于定制化开发。通过这些高级功能,我们可以更灵活地实现动态参数配置、复杂的业务逻辑处理,以及与其他系统的对接集成。
市面上的低代码开发平台如雨后春笋般涌现,选对工具对于项目的成功尤为关键。以下是选择低代码平台的一些重点考量:
低代码无疑为开发者和企业带来了许多便利,但在使用时要注意的一点是,不要盲目追求"低代码"而忽视系统质量。一个真实的开发场景往往需要在速度和深度之间找到平衡点。有时候,为了保证系统安全性或者功能扩展性,某些地方还是需要手写一些代码来保持灵活性。
随着人工智能和机器学习技术的不断进化,低代码未来的潜力让人充满想象。例如,未来的开发工具可能会嵌入智能推荐功能,自动为你生成最佳的数据库结构或优化的API设计;甚至低代码平台还会广泛应用到硬核 DevOps 流程中,改变云环境部署和运维的方式。
毫无疑问,低代码技术已经成为工业化软件开发的一颗新星。既然我们身处这样一个高效开发的新世纪,为何不试试用它来让开发变得更轻松、更高效呢?
最后,无论你采用哪一种开发方式,不断地学习新技术、熟悉业务需求、提升自己的代码能力,依然是做好一个优秀开发者最重要的底层逻辑。希望本文能为你开启低代码后端开发的大门,期待你在自己的开发之路上不断创造新的奇迹!
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。
相关文章推荐
立即开启你的数字化管理
用心为每一位用户提供专业的数字化解决方案及业务咨询